Transaction 6596eeea71e46a24664b6c114c8ba07a16f8f5ccc8eb80b467d8cdce8d6845be

1 Input
2 Outputs
  • 6596eeea71e46a24664b6c114c8ba07a16f8f5ccc8eb80b467d8cdce8d6845be:0
  • value  2013000
    address  1CwpSVDchSTHZ485BRjNN6kiehha7ucEsf
  • 6596eeea71e46a24664b6c114c8ba07a16f8f5ccc8eb80b467d8cdce8d6845be:1
  • value  10299966916
    address  3LpqazFsoyNcSivc3M6u7yL9iK9YbUGURu